Create Screenshots Of Twitter Tweets And post Them To Blog, Tumblr Or Any Other Web Page
Technology Sunday, May 11th, 2008If you want to show a Twitter message by someone on your tumblr page, blog or website, use tweetshots. The service allows you to create screenshots of Twitter tweets that can be embedded in any web page. They also have integration with Tumblr to let you post screenshots directly to your Tumblr page.
If you go to tweetshots home page, the first impression that you will have is ‘how do I actually take a screenshot’ as there is no help information available on the page and the interface is non-intuitive. I don’t know why people make so confusing to find out how their service works.
So here’s how to take screenshots of Twitter tweets using tweetshots. Go to the home page and enter your bookmarklet name in the defined box. You don’t have to do anything with “What am I doing?” box and pressing the “tweetshots” button didn’t work at my end.
After entering the name, drag the bookmarklet link to your browser’s bookmark toolbar.
Now open any page containing a single twitter update like this and click on the bookmarklet. On the nest screen, click the “Grab the tweetshot” link to create the screenshot.
On the next screen, you will see the screenshot along with the embed code and link to post the screenshot to Tumblr.
